types-from-sql
Version:
14 lines (13 loc) • 363 B
TypeScript
import { Client } from 'pg'
import DataLoader from 'dataloader'
export interface IField {
columnID: number
tableID: number
}
export declare class SqlAnalyzer {
client: Client
constructor(client: Client)
getInterface(query: string): Promise<string>
getInterfaceName(query: string): string
nullabilityDataLoader: DataLoader<IField, boolean, IField>
}